CYLINDER/PISTON/CRANKSHAFT
Remove the bearing caps and measure the com-
pressed plastigauge at its widest point on each
crankpin to determine the oil clearance.
SERVICE LIMIT: 0.06 mm (0.002 in)
If the oil clearance exceeds the service limit, select
the correct replacement bearings.

After selecting new bearings, recheck the oil clear-
ance with plastigauge. Incorrect oil clearance can
cause major engine damage.
